We're here to help!Antarctica Cruises Top 25 Products and ServicesAmazing Antarctica: Our 25 Top Antarctica Cruises 1. Antarctica is one of the most spectacular destinations in the entire world. For scenery, wildlife, and sheer beauty, a trip to this region of the world can’t be beat. Most cruises are educational and life changing. 2. 10 Day Antarctica Cruise. 3. Sail with Quark Expeditions on a magical journey through the Beagle Channel, across the Drake Passage, and around the Antarctic Peninsula. 4. A trip to Antarctica is incomparable to most other journeys in the world. It involves remote travel to stunningly beautiful areas that few people have seen. Explorers to Antarctica view the world in an entirely different light and many of them become strong advocates for preserving the environment. 5. Quark Expeditions also offers cruises to Antarctica that run from 11-29 days. 6. Abercrombie & Kent, Aurora Expeditions, Fathom Expeditions, Hapag-Lloyd Kreuzfahrten, Heritage Expeditions, Lindblad Expeditions, Mountain Travel-Sobek, Peregrine, Oceanwide Expeditions, Rederij Bark Europa BV, and WildWings/WildOceans Travel all offer cruises to Antarctica. 7. Travelers can’t go wrong sailing with Quark; it has trips and prices for even budget conscious explorers. 8. Ushuaia, Argentina. The world’s Southern most city is where the majority of cruises depart from. 9. The Beagle Channel. The 150 mile long passageway offers cruise-goers magnificent scenery. 10. The Drake Passage. This is where the warm waters of the Pacific Ocean meet the Antarctic sea. 11. Educational lectures. Opportunities to learn about global warming and other environmental topics are discussed on board. 12. Five star dining. Quark offers exquisite meals. 13. Albatross. See birds with wingspans up to 11 feet. 14. Penguins. Adelie and Chinstrap penguins chat merrily away. 15. Icebergs. Giant icebergs awe passengers. 16. Mountains. Snow capped peaks are often shrouded in clouds. 17. Penguin Island. The name says it all. 18. On-board bar. Passengers can meet other travelers and relax with a bit of alcohol in the bar area of the ship. 19. Earnest Shackleton. Some journeys track part of the famed leader's expeditions. 20. Cape Horn. It's possible to sail near this landmark. 21. Polar bear swimming. Brave passengers bear all and jump into the frigid waters of the Antarctic. 22. Glaciers. Giant glaciers ooh and ah travelers. 23. Ice chocked channels. Beautiful chunks of ice float peacefully past cruise ships. 24. Seals sleeping on ice-floes. Wildlife viewers with discerning eyes can see seals peacefully sleeping on ice floes in the middle of the sea. 25. Science research bases. Lucky passengers get to visit at least one science research base and have their passports stamped for "vanity purposes." |
